    When full time whistle announced the score brave Seandúns did declare,
    That they had much to learn from Our Footballers from Beare.
    4.
    Just a few weeks later our boys were called again,
    To meet the County Champions from Macroom the heroes came,
    From Macroom they came with flags unfurled in motors grand and gay,
    Unbounded hopes in their famed team they surely had that day,
    Their backers staunch and joyful of defeat they would not hear.
    But they had to lower their colours to Our Footballers from Beare.
    5
    When the Summer's sun was shining one glorious afternoon,
    To Bantry town once more went forth our boys to meet their doom,
    Such was the faith in Carbery’s team their followers did declare,
    That Godfrey’s Inch would seal the fate of Our Footballers from Beare.
    6
    At 3 o’clock the match began both teams were fleet as deer,
